Review of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ri (2017) by Macsmusic — 29 Dec 2017
This is a pretty heavy movie, and there is a lot of stuff to unpack. It deals with several different political issues in an offhanded way that works really well. Several lines from this movie stuck with me after leaving the theater.
The acting is really good and most, but not all, of the comedy works pretty well. This movie was filmed perfectly. One scene had me in tears just because of the blaring music and brutality happening in the scene.
Hate and forgiveness are the biggest themes of the movie, and the way forgiveness is portrayed on screen is really incredible. The characters are all interesting and very well acted. All in all, a really amazing movie that mixes depth and comedy very well with great acting.
